Here we have grilled cheese sticks, perfect for dipping into the soup.
Throw together your favorite soup; I of course went for a thick creamy tomato soup.
We will make the cheese sticks with a cheese that melts fairly quickly, (I am not a big fan of processed cheese, but will use it if need be) I used Kraft singles. I know, I know, this is not even sold as a cheese, it is just called “Singles” with that being said, it is the cheese of yesteryear, what we all used to have as a family, what typically is used for grilled cheese (basic) sandwiches. I am not going gourmet today, I am going easy comfort food. Sometimes that is what is needed!
Flatten out your bread, we used wheat.
Cut the ends off, place a slice of cheese onto the bread and tightly roll. Make three per person (or more if needed) Cook in butter turning until crispy on the outside.
Serve with your soup.
